The Shakur Family postpones trip to South Africa until 2007
For personal reasons, Tupac's mother, Afeni Shakur, has postponed the family's proposed trip to South Africa, to commemorate the 10th anniversary of his death. The Tupac Amaru Shakur Foundation will continue with its plans in Atlanta to commemorate the 10th anniversary of Tupac’s death by inviting the public to the Peace Garden on Saturday, September 9th at 1:00pm. Afeni Shakur and the staff of the Center are asking everyone to bring a plant in memory of a loved one to place in the Peace Garden. If people cannot attend, the Center asks that a plant be laid in their personal garden in memory of not only, their loved ones, but for all fallen heroes. A celebration and drum ceremony will follow the garden event.
The trip to South Africa will now take place on June 16, 2007. The date coincides with the anniversary of the Soweto uprising as well as Tupac’s 36th birthday. Mrs. Shakur has always been a supporter for Civil Rights and rescheduling the ceremony on this day characterizes her son’s legacy as he shares the day he came into the world with such a powerful political and social movement. “My family and I regret that they must postpone the trip to South Africa to a later date, due to personal reasons,” says Ms. Shakur. “We understand the work and time that everyone has put into making this trip possible but the work of helping the children and sick of South Africa must continue. We will still be sending aid and relief to those organizations and groups that we have established relationships with including the Nelson Mandela Foundation. Over the next couple of months, we want to spend time strengthening those ties. The invitation for the two students to come over to the Tupac Shakur Center on an exchange remains open and we intend to see it to fruition.”
The Tupac Amaru Shakur Foundation was formed to bring a quality arts program to our young people by providing a positive and healthy foundation for them to build and grow upon. To date over 500 students have benefited from the program with a broad range of training available via the Annual Performing Arts Camp. Students are able to study creative writing, vocal technique, acting, stage set design, dance, poetry and spoken word. The Foundation has also hosted Essay competitions throughout the U.S., charity Golf Tournaments and awarded scholarships to students pursuing undergraduate degrees.

WHO IS JIBBS?
Jibbs knew he had to do something to get the attention of his older brother, (DJ Beats from the production team Da Beatstaz {DJ Beats & Reese Beats}). So the then 8-year-old wrote a rap and performed it for his brother, who was gaining fame in St. Louis producing for such hip-hop stars as Nelly and Chingy. Floored by Jibbs’ flow, DJ Beats started having his pre-teen brother join him in the studio. Jibbs’ jaw-dropping freestyles earned him a rep as a premier rapper in the St. Louis underground.
“I was murdering 21-year-olds, 25-year-olds when I was 11 and 12,” Jibbs recalls with a laugh. “That’s how people knew me in the hood. They’d be like, ‘You’re so young, but you whupped him -- and he’s supposed to be good.’”
Once Jibbs’ demo started circulating among music industry insiders, the calls came. He was courted by several labels and started opening up for such superstars as Chris Brown, Bow Wow and Young Jeezy when they performed in the Lou. The impact was profound. “It motivated me even more when I saw that people really liked my music,” says Jibbs, whose music has the catchiness of Nelly and the lyrical acumen of T.I. “I got a better response than I thought I would.”
Now signed to IGA’s Geffen Records (home to Snoop Dogg, Slim Thug, Common, Pharrell, Mos Def, Mary J. Blige) and riding the success of his new single “Chain Hang Low”, the teen rapper is set to change the game with the release of his dynamic debut album, Jibbs feat. Jibbs. He came up with the title as a nod to his musical diversity. “Every song on the album doesn’t sound the same,” he explains. “That’s where the title Jibbs feat. Jibbs came from. No songs sound the same, but you’ll always know it’s me.”
With a sing-along chorus, clever braggadocio and a block-rocking beat, “Chain Hang Low” has become a street favorite. “Smile,” a percolating collaboration with Fabo of D4L, introduces new dances to the world, while “Hood” showcases Jibbs’ introspective side. Here, he challenges people to think before they do something that could lead to trouble.
Fortunately, Jibbs had the benefit of a strong family unit, one where his parents and all six of their children worked hard to constantly improve themselves and their surroundings - - making the family a success story in its own right. Indeed, Jibbs has two significant outlets to help steer him away from the traps that lure many ghetto youth into dead-end lives. His parents and older brothers were into music, and he and his three brothers were all boxers. In fact, Jibbs was such a good boxer that he became a two-time Golden Glove Champion, a remarkable accomplishment in the competitive boxing world. Despite his success in the ring, Jibbs was driven to be a rapper. “Music inspires me more,” he says. “I feel that I’m better at music. I was real good at boxing, but I feel music is where my heart is. I love it so much that nothing can stop me from doing it.”
Now, with the remarkably engaging Jibbs feat. Jibbs, set for release in September 2006, the teen rapper is ready to establish himself as a trendsetting artist. “I want to bring some new flavor to the game as a youngster in the business,” he says. “I want to change it up a little bit. I also want to show teenagers that they can make it, just like I did. I came from the hood just like they did and I made it better.”

Born in Buffalo , NY in 1980, Emiles love for Hiphop started at a very early age, as he was already selling pause tapes in Junior High School; an endeavor that proved so successful he was able to parlay those sales into the purchase of his first pair of turntables.
After some run-ins with the law as a youth and a subsequent house arrest sentence, Emile found himself locked indoors, which only further harnessed his turntable skills. By 1997, Emile was a known entity in Buffalo and after his friend lent him his sampler he had found where his true passion resided---producing. In 1998, Emile decided to leave Buffalo and headed for the bright lights of NYC to pursue his dream. Emile found a job selling sneakers by day and by night you could find him creating beats and searching for emcees to bless them.
Two short years later, Emile sold his first beat to Rodney Jerkins (who has produced for Michael Jackson, Britney Spears, Jennifer Lopez, Destinys Child, Mary J. Blige, Toni Braxton, Aaliyah, Alicia Keys, Fantasia, Jadakiss, TLC etc) and though the track never came out, Emile quit his day job and focused 100% of his time and effort on beatmaking. In 2001, Emile connected with Eminem protg Obie Trice and contributed two tracks to Obies platinum debut, Cheers, including the LPs third-single, Dont Come Down,? which he co-produced with Eminem. Emiles work with Obie caught the ear of none other then Proof and the two collaborated on two tracks for Proofs solo-debut Searching For Jerry Garcia. Emile fondly recalls working with Proof: If anyone were to ask me which record I produced is the most important to me, the answer comes easy. Kurt Kobain? by my good friend Proof. I get chills every time I listen to it. Its his goodbye letter to the world, in the form of a song. Anybody who listens to the song can tell how deep it is; and how ill it is that its the last song on his album.
From 2002-2005 Emile stayed on his grind as his reputation grew bigger, as he worked with a virtual whos who list of artists; including contributing two-tracks to M.O.P.s now shelved Roc-A-Fella debut, Ghetto Warfare, Terror Squads Gold Album, True Story, Ghosfaces Pretty Toney LP, Raekwons Lex Diamonds Story, three tracks on Cormegas 2004 LP True Meaning and three tracks from his 2005 LP Legal Hustle, Everlasts White Trash Beautiful and contributed the official NY street anthem of 2005 on AZs A.W.O.L. with New York featuring Ghostface, Raekwon and DJ Premier. While Emiles credits thru 2005 were glowing, in 2006 he promises to ascend further up the Hiphop production ranks and become a household name!
Every producer has a track that they can go back to in their past, which for them served as there respective Break-Out production: for Emile, Obie Trices They Wanna Know from Obies sophomore solo-LP, Second Rounds On Me certainly looks like the track Emile will look back on five years from now and realize was just that; its already served as the theme song for the 3rd season of HBOs wildly successful show Entourage and is being widely hailed as one of the best tracks to emerge from 2006. In addition, Emile has already completed tracks for a diverse range of artists for projects that have already dropped or are slated to appear this year; including Snoop Doggs The Blue Carpet Treatment, the bonus track (Pity The Child?) on The Roots Game Theory, two tracks on Ice Cubes almost Gold Laugh Now, Cry Later LP, two tracks (including the standout Bullet And A Target f/Citizen Cope & Jon Brion) on Rhymefests Blue Collar, Remy Mas Theres Something About Remy, two tracks on Kay Slays The Champions and Funk Flexs The Car Show. Emile even has tracks completed for a slew of releases that will appear in 2007; including three tracks from the solo-debut of Jurassic 5s Chali 2NA, Aasim, Jae Millz, Papoose and new Interscope artist Lanz.
Though Emile has already made a name for himself in the production ranks, he realizes the importance of being a savvy businessman as well, as he recently opened his own brand spanking new recording studio in SOHO , where he plans to station himself out of.

The Con Man is back up in the building and all the fans of G.O.O.D. music need to pay attention. For those who don't know, Consequence earned his hip-hop stripes back in 1993 alongside hip-hop super group A Tribe Called Quest. Cons made his rap debut on one of hip-hop's most cherished albums: Midnight Marauders, the 3rd album from Ali Shaheed, Phife Dawg, and Cons' cousin Q-Tip.
The Queens , NY native made his real splash, however, when he touched up the Tribe's platinum Beats, Rhymes & Life for seven tracks, including the backpacker classic "Phony Rappers" and the hit "Stressed Out" with Faith Evans.
Consequence was as close to a fourth member as ATCQ could ever have, but in 2004, he found himself in the company of a second family: G.O.O.D. Music, the record label of Kanye West. Soon after he appeared on another hip-hop classic, Kanye's debut College Dropout, as Cons appeared on the huge hit "Spaceship."
With the extended G.O.O.D. (Getting Out Our Dreams) family in his corner, Consequence's stock is higher than ever. Awaiting the release of his G.O.O.D. debut Don't Quit Your Day Job (due out later in 2006), Consequence scratches his itch and teams up with Clinton Sparks and the G.O.O.D. Music Family and returns to the mixtape scene with the 4th edition of The Cons, his acclaimed undergound mixtape series, entitled Finish What You Started
Representing Cons' journey from ATCQ fame to underground mixtape fame to a major label album release and world tour, "Finish What You Started" is a celebration of Cons' efforts in the rap game.
MixUnit.coms very own Clinton Sparks has a g.o.o.d. connection with the G.O.O.D. family, having already done two mixtapes with Kanye West (Touch The Sky and Smashtime Radio, vol. 1), DJ'ed for G.O.O.D.'s Grammy party, and setting up Mix Unit Collabos with G.O.O.D. affiliates like GLC and Rhymefest. So when it came time for G.O.O.D. to drop the official mixtape before his anticipated album, recruiting Clinton Sparks was a no-brainer!
The Cons, Vol. 4 mixtape features more than 20 new and exclusive tracks/freestyles from Consequence, including key cameos from G.O.O.D.'s Kanye West, GLC, Mary J Blige, Bathgate, Sa-Ra and new production from Clinton Sparks on two exclusive tracks.
Finishing what he started, Consequence, G.O.O.D. Music and Clinton Sparks team up with MixUnit.com to bring you this official Mix Unit Artist Series edition mixtape.

SAN FRANCISCO, Sept. 6 /PRNewswire/ -- Global creative and brand- engineering agency ATTIK ( http://www.attik.com/ ) today announced their role in designing and launching the website http://www.hypewilliams.com/ in time for the renowned director himself, Hype Williams, to be honored with the Video Vanguard Award at last night's MTV Video Music Awards. At the height of the star-studded, Aug. 31 live event held at New York's Radio City Music Hall, millions of simultaneous MTV and MTV.com viewers watched as Missy Elliott, Kanye West and Busta Rhymes presented Williams with the prestigious award.
In anticipation of the honor, just weeks before the event, Williams had renewed his past working relationship with ATTIK, to have the company design and launch his official website, complete with 100 of his own photographs, and 50 digitally remastered versions of his most famous music videos.
"Back in 2000, I was invited by fashion designer Julien Macdonald to produce his 'Modern Skins' show at the Millennium Dome on the final evening of London Fashion Week," Williams explained. "I hired ATTIK for that project, to create an artistic, high-tech backdrop for the show, and I felt that their work was truly phenomenal. So, when I learned that I might be up for this award, I got them back onboard to get the site up and going. I gave them a lot of input on what I wanted, and not a lot of time to get it done, but as I expected, they came through in style.
Along with design director Stan Zienka, ATTIK's project team consisted of junior designer Ryan Lee and project manager Oliver Ralph. Using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ator, as well as Macromedia Dreamweaver and Flash, the designers adapted the look and feel of the company's past 'Modern Skins' artwork for the new site. The assignment also involved recompressing the music videos and optimizing them for streaming, as well as establishing the most robust hosting platform available, which was secured through Pier One Management, to ensure that the site can handle maximum traffic for its several gigabytes'-worth of spectacular contents.
"Hype had requested a minimal and predominantly white aesthetic for the website design," Zienka said. "It was something that we felt would be simple and allow the user to get to the vast quantity of Hype's work easily. The background textures were reminiscent of the past video project we had done with Hype; a combination of in-camera light experiments and digital compositions."
The new site's traffic exceeded nearly 20,000 hits in the first 24 hours after Williams received his award, which is remarkable in that the site was not yet registered in search engines.
Since 1994, Williams has directed over 200 music videos for the world's top recording artists, including Aaliyah, DMX, Kanye West, Nas, No Doubt, Outkast, and many, many others. Past Video Vanguard recipients include David Bowie, Madonna, U2 and Michael Jackson.
Other awards for Williams' work in the music video field include the Billboard Music Video Award for Best Director of the Year (1996), the Jackson Limo Award for Best Rap Video of the Year (1996) for Busta Rhymes' "Woo Hah," the NAACP Image Award (1997), MTV Video Music Award in the Best Rap Video (1998) category for Will Smith's "Gettin' Jiggy Wit It," MTV Video Music Award for Best Group Video (1999) for TLC's "No Scrubs," MTV Video Music Award for Best R&B Video (2006) for Beyonce's "Check Up On It," and the BET Award for Best Director (2006) for Kanye West's "Gold Digger." He made his feature film directorial debut in 1998 with "Belly," which has since gained a huge cult following, and he has also directed remarkable commercial campaigns for leading global brands, including Nike, MasterCard, Revlon, Fubu, Toyota, Verizon, Reebok, The Gap, and Dolce & Gabbana. From inception to inspiration...
In 1996 a small underground hip-hop event was launched at London's Shepherds Bush Empire. Its aim was to put a much needed spotlight on the effect and reach of b-boy culture by showing the art of battle between b-boy crews. With a rare UK appearance from b-boy icon Crazy Legs promised and live performances by the UK's very own London Posse and one of Philly's finest, Schoolly D, a crowd of hip-hop heads and old skoolers packed the venue to witness the birth of the U.K B-Boy Championships and a ever developing relationship with Sony Computer Entertainment. The vibe, combined with the genuine emotion of the almost forgotten heroes of the scene and the amazing spectacle, set in motion a tidal wave of breakin' fever and b-boying's second coming!
The PlayStation U.K B-Boy Championships has established itself as one of the worlds greatest Hip-Hop events, with national qualifiers in Japan, Korea, USA & Europe. The Championships features the best Solo Breakers, Poppers, Lockers and the greatest B-boy Crews from across the world. It also plays host to some of the most exciting Hip-Hop artists to visit the UK. The Championships is easily the most eagerly anticipated event in the Hip-Hop calendar.
And if sponsoring the event itself for the last 11 years wasn't enough, PlayStation's affiliation with the UK B-Boy Championships has finally led to the creation of a new game, B-Boy(TM). Developed by FreeStyleGames, in collaboration with Crazy Legs and DJ Hooch, B-Boy is due for release in September 2006 on PlayStation Portable (PSP) and PlayStation 2.
B-Boy the game uses a dynamically controlled fighting system to help you battle the best b-boys on the planet and even features scenes from the UK B-Boy Championships within it. In "B-Boy Life" mode, players build up a crew and battle against real-life superstar b-boys including in-game and real-life host Crazy Legs.
Carl Christopher from PlayStation commented: "Over the many years of sponsorship, we have talked about taking the inspiration from the Championships to create a B-Boy game. Now it's here, we are all excited. This games comes with all the authenticity of b-boy culture, featuring the top b-boys from the around the world, and the dynamic game play we always dreamed of, enjoy!"
Sony Ericsson is also now heavily committed to the Championships after becoming involved last year. The association with the b-boying stems from Sony Ericsson's ability to allow music to be carried anywhere and anytime through the stylish Walkman(R) range of handsets, and the diverse urban culture of the b-boys perfectly encapsulates this distinct approach to music and fashion.
Sony Ericsson is soon to launch/has recently launched the W710i handset, which will feature at the Championships, enabling physical performance to be measured whilst listening to your favourite music on the move, the perfect accessory for budding inner-city sports addicts.

Mouse
Coming from a diverse streetdance background, Ereson 'Mouse' Catipon started bboying when he moved to Manchester, England in 1996 from the Philippines. The winner of numerous solo bboy titles, Mouse's name has gained international respect as the forerunner of the UK breaking scene. Mouse has qualified for next years Redbull BC One to be held in Brazil and was a finalist at the Hip Hop Challenge in Germany earlier this year losing to Korea's amazing Hong 10. He is also one of the characters from the all new PS2 & PSP game 'B-Boy'.
Steady
From Jamaican heritage, Steady started breaking as a cheeky kid from Derby in the 80s during the first wave of b-boys. He is one of the few originals from his generation to have maintained the dance through the years and has helped to revive the scene in the UK, introducing numerous kids to b-boying. Now, at his peak, his energy and entertaining showmanship make him not only one of the UK's finest breakers but also an incredible performer. Steady is the current world record holder for the most windmills.
